WebLumbar radiculopathy is irritation or inflammation of a nerve root in the low back. It causes symptoms that spread out from the back down one or both legs. To understand this condition, it helps to understand the parts of the spine: Vertebrae. These are bones that stack to form the spine. The lumbar spine contains the 5 bottom vertebrae. Disks.
